You can have Juicy Hamburger Steak in Steak Sauce using 14 ingredients and 6 steps. Here is how you cook that.
Ingredients of Juicy Hamburger Steak in Steak Sauce
- Prepare 200 grams of Domestic mixed ground meat.
- You need 1/2 large of Onion.
- You need 1 tbsp of Cooked rice.
- Prepare 4 tbsp of Panko.
- Prepare 1 of Egg.
- Prepare 2 tsp of ☆Nutmeg.
- Prepare 1 tsp of ☆ Umami seasoning.
- It’s 1 of ☆Salt and pepper.
- It’s 1 tsp of ☆Paprika powder.
- It’s of [Steak Sauce].
- Prepare 2 tbsp of Soy sauce.
- Prepare 2 tbsp of Mirin.
- It’s 2 tbsp of Cooking sake.
- Prepare 1 1/2 tbsp of Margarine or butter.

Juicy Hamburger Steak in Steak Sauce instructions
- Mince the onions and add to a heat-resistant plate. Cover with wrap and microwave for 2 minutes. Set aside and leave to cool..
- Add the ground meat -> the onions from Step 1 -> the egg -> the rice -> and the panko to the bowl and mix together. Mix in the ☆ ingredients. Continue to mix until it's sticky..
- Form the mixture into a hamburger shape. Pound the meat to remove any air, and make a shallow well in the center..
- Cook in an oiled frying pan on low to medium heat for 2 minutes. Turn over, cover with a lid, and cook on low heat for 5 to 6 minutes. Once it's cooked remove the hamburger steak..
- In the frying pan from Step 4, add the steak sauce ingredients, except for the margarine. Bring to a boil. Add the margarine last and bring to a simmer again..
- Cover the hamburger with the steak sauce and it's done..
